This year is the 10th Annual Toys for Tots trial in North Carolina hosted by the Big Elf, Ron Young, with help and support from NADAC and many other local elves and princesses. The raffle that goes along with the trial is a great source of additional funds to support Toys for Tots and we are hoping to make this year's raffle better than ever.
Any and all donations are encouraged and appreciated. Donations will of course be accepted at the trial, but if you have an item or items you would like to donate but aren't going to be able to attend the trial, you can contact me or Karen Merriman or Becky Spring and we will do our best to separate you from your gifts. For folks on the East Coast, Karen is going to be at the All About Animals trial this weekend, the BAD trial next weekend and the ITZ trial the weekend before Toys for Tots, and she will take your donations and bring them to Toys for Tots with her.
Star City Canine Training Club in Roanoke, Virginia is donating an entry to our spring trial and we would like to invite/challenge other clubs to do the same. We will be posting as we become aware of other donations to the raffle so you can plan your strategy!
If you would like to make a general donation to Toys for Tots, we will be glad to take those new, unwrapped toys from you as well, and of course plain old money works, too!
